Maceration and extraction enzymes are used to help release juice from grapes and desired contents such as flavor, tannin, color and other key phenolic compounds from juice and skins.
PEKTOZYME ® Mash Liquid pectinase 20 kg Popular Premium White, Red & Rosé Wines
Dose Rate: 18 - 63 mL/ton of fruit Red and Rosé: Dose at crusher or while filling fermentation tank. If thermovinification is used, enzyme should be added when the temperature is below 55 °C / 131 °F. White: Dose in transportation bins or at crusher prior to pressing Dose Rate: 27 - 45 mL/ton of fruit Dose at crusher or while filling fermentation tank. If thermovinification is used, enzyme should be added when temperature is below 55 °C / 131 °F. Dose Rate: 27 - 36 mL/ton of fruit Dose in transportation bins or at crusher prior to pressing.
• Optimize large scale winemaking with liquid enzyme • Increase extraction of anthocyanins, tannins, varietal flavor and aroma compounds • Higher free run yields with lower pressure while preserving aroma and quality
BioSelect ® Noir Micro-granulate pectinase 250 g Premium Red Wines
• Release anthocyanins, tannins, and polysaccharides early in maceration
• Increase color extraction and improve color stability • Enhance soft tannin extraction without increased astringency for more structure and improved mouthfeel • Recommended for long maceration wines • Increase varietal intensity through the selective release of flavor and aroma compounds from grape skin • Reduce skin contact time for higher quality juice • Higher free run yields and more efficient pressing at lower pressures • Purified to control cinnamoyl esterase activity and preserve delicate aromas

Clarification and filtration enzymes are used to maximize clarification speed and yield. They improve settling or flotation while reducing the volume of gross lees.
PEKTOZYME ® Clear Liquid pectinase 20 kg Popular Premium White, Red & Rosé Wines
Dose Rate: 9 - 14 mL/ton of fruit
• Achieve complete depectinization and fast clarification • Excellent for flotation applications • Increase press efficiency and clarification of grape must • Optimize large scale winemaking with liquid enzyme
Dose at the crusher, during filling of the clarification tank or prior to flotation or centrifugation.

Aroma liberation enzymes release bound terpenes in white wines, allowing for the natural fruit and floral characteristics in the wine to be revealed and aid in post fermentation clarification.
BioSelect ® Aroma Plus Micro-granulate pectinase with β-glucosidase 250 g Premium White Wines
Dose Rate: 198 - 228 mL/ton of fruit Dose at the end of or after alcoholic fermentation. Apply bentonite treatment after desired aroma profile is achieved.
• Free bound terpenes to enhance varietal aroma in white wines • Use with newly fermented or existing wines • Recommended for Muscat, Riesling, Gewürztraminer, and similar wine styles
